SUMMARY:BPC General Assembly – 27 May 2026
DESCRIPTION:The BPC General Assembly will take place on Wednesday 27 May 2026 at 11:30 a.m. This annual event represents a key moment in the life of the non-profit organisation. It provides an opportunity to review past activities, present future perspectives, and address the various items on the agenda as set out in the invitation sent to members.\nThe meeting will be held at COOP, an emblematic site dedicated to the circular economy and innovative initiatives in sustainable production. Located in the former industrial buildings of the Anderlecht slaughterhouses, COOP brings together a wide range of stakeholders engaged in the economic and environmental transition, serving as a meeting place for companies, entrepreneurs, and impact-driven projects.\nThe session will conclude with a speech by Mayor Fabrice Cumps. It will be followed by a guided visit of the COOP site, led by Marc Renson, COOP board member and President of Euclides.\nA walking lunch will conclude the morning, offering an informal setting for further exchanges among participants.\nParticipation reserved for members.\n
